MENU

AIと数学のコラボレーションで生まれるイノベーション

# AIと数学のコラボレーションで生まれるイノベーション

皆様、こんにちは。テクノロジーの進化が加速する現代において、AIと数学の融合がもたらす革新的な変化に注目が集まっています。人工知能技術が私たちの生活や産業に浸透する中、その根幹を支える数学的知識の重要性はますます高まっています。

最先端のAI研究では、複雑な数式やアルゴリズムが驚くべき成果を生み出しています。ディープラーニングの背後には線形代数や確率論、微分方程式といった数学的概念が精緻に組み込まれており、これらを理解することがAI開発の鍵となっているのです。

実際、ChatGPTやMidjourneyなど話題のAIツールも、数学的基盤なくしては実現し得なかった技術です。テック業界では数学的素養を持つ人材の需要が急増し、従来の枠を超えた活躍の場が広がっています。

本記事では、AIと数学の密接な関係性を紐解きながら、最新研究から見える未来の可能性や、AI開発に不可欠な数学的概念、そして数学者がテック業界で求められる理由まで、幅広く解説していきます。AI技術者を目指す方はもちろん、数学の実用的価値に興味をお持ちの方にとっても、新たな視点を提供できる内容となっています。

数式とアルゴリズムが織りなす次世代のイノベーションの世界へ、どうぞご案内いたします。

1. 「数学の力でAIはどこまで進化する?最新研究から見える未来の可能性」

# タイトル: AIと数学のコラボレーションで生まれるイノベーション

## 1. 「数学の力でAIはどこまで進化する?最新研究から見える未来の可能性」

人工知能(AI)の進化を支える根幹技術として、数学の役割が注目されています。特に深層学習の飛躍的な発展は、線形代数、微積分、確率統計といった数学的基盤なしには実現不可能でした。実際、グーグルのDeepMindが開発したAlphaGoやAlphaFoldなどの革新的AIシステムは、複雑な数学的アルゴリズムの上に構築されています。

最近の研究では、トポロジー(位相幾何学)を活用したニューラルネットワークの新構造が注目を集めています。この構造により、従来のAIが苦手としていた空間認識や、データの本質的な構造理解が飛躍的に向上しています。例えば、ハーバード大学とMITの共同研究チームは、トポロジカルデータ分析を用いて医療画像診断の精度を15%以上向上させることに成功しました。

また、非ユークリッド幾何学の応用により、グラフニューラルネットワークの性能が向上しています。これにより、ソーシャルネットワーク分析や創薬研究などの複雑なグラフ構造を持つデータ解析が格段に進化しています。スタンフォード大学の研究グループは、この技術を用いて新型ウイルスに対する治療薬候補を従来の10分の1の時間で特定することに成功しています。

カオス理論と複雑系数学の導入により、AIの予測能力も向上しています。気象予報や株価予測など、従来は予測が困難だった非線形システムに対しても高い精度で予測が可能になりつつあります。特に日本気象協会が導入した新しい気象予測AIは、従来のモデルと比較して台風の進路予測の誤差を約30%減少させることに成功しました。

一方で、数理論理学の発展がAIの説明可能性と信頼性向上に貢献しています。ブラックボックス問題と呼ばれるAIの判断根拠の不透明さは、特に医療や法律などの重要な意思決定分野での応用に障壁となっていました。形式論理と確率論を組み合わせた新しい数学フレームワークにより、AIの判断プロセスを人間が理解できる形で表現する研究が進んでいます。

数学とAIの融合は今後も加速し、量子コンピューティングとの掛け合わせにより、現在の計算能力では解決できない問題への挑戦も可能になるでしょう。今後も数学の新たな分野がAI研究に取り入れられることで、私たちの想像を超えるイノベーションが生まれる可能性を秘めています。

2. 「数式が解き明かすディープラーニングの秘密 – 知っておくべき数学的基盤とその応用」

2. 「数式が解き明かすディープラーニングの秘密 – 知っておくべき数学的基盤とその応用」

ディープラーニングの世界は美しい数式で満ち溢れています。一見すると複雑に見えるAIの内部構造も、数学という言語で紐解くと驚くほど論理的で洗練されたシステムであることがわかります。

まず理解すべきは「勾配降下法」です。これはディープラーニングの最適化アルゴリズムの基盤となる数学概念で、多次元空間における最小値を効率的に探索する方法です。数式で表すと、θ = θ – α∇J(θ)となります。この単純な式がAIの学習プロセス全体を支えているのです。

さらに重要なのが「バックプロパゲーション」です。これは誤差逆伝播法とも呼ばれ、ニューラルネットワークの重みを調整するための微分の連鎖律を応用した手法です。この数学的テクニックにより、各層の重みがどれだけ最終的な誤差に貢献しているかを計算できます。

畳み込みニューラルネットワーク(CNN)では、画像認識において重要な「畳み込み操作」が使われます。これは信号処理の数学から借用された概念で、画像の特徴を抽出するための数学的フィルタリング手法です。行列演算という基本的な線形代数の知識がここでは不可欠です。

自然言語処理の分野では「トランスフォーマー」アーキテクチャが注目されていますが、これはマルチヘッドアテンションという数学的概念に基づいています。行列の積と確率分布を組み合わせた巧妙な仕組みが、GPTなどの大規模言語モデルの基盤となっています。

これらの数学的基盤を理解することで、AIは単なるブラックボックスではなく、理論的に説明可能なテクノロジーとして活用できるようになります。例えば、Google DeepMindでは数学的原理に基づいた研究により、AlphaGoやAlphaFoldといった画期的なAIシステムを開発しました。

実務においても、この知識は重要です。FinTechのQuantexa社は、グラフ理論と確率モデルを組み合わせたAIシステムで金融詐欺検出を飛躍的に向上させました。また、医療分野ではSiemens Healthineersが微分方程式を応用した画像再構成アルゴリズムで、MRI診断の精度を高めています。

数学とAIの融合は、今後も無限の可能性を秘めています。基本的な線形代数、微積分、確率統計の知識を深めることで、次世代のAIイノベーションに貢献できるでしょう。

3. 「AI開発者必見!複雑なアルゴリズムを支える5つの数学的概念とその実装方法」

# タイトル: AIと数学のコラボレーションで生まれるイノベーション

## 見出し: 3. 「AI開発者必見!複雑なアルゴリズムを支える5つの数学的概念とその実装方法」

AIの進化が加速する現在、開発の最前線では数学の深い理解が不可欠になっています。実際のところ、高度なAIアルゴリズムの背後には、常に堅固な数学的基盤が存在します。この記事では、AI開発において必須となる5つの数学的概念と、それらをどのように実装に活かすかを解説します。

1. 線形代数:ベクトル空間とAI表現

線形代数はAI開発の基礎中の基礎です。例えば、ニューラルネットワークの各層では、入力ベクトルに重み行列を掛け合わせる線形変換が行われます。TensorFlowやPyTorchでは、これらの演算が最適化されていますが、その仕組みを理解するには行列計算の知識が必須です。

実装のポイント:大規模な行列計算では、SVD(特異値分解)を用いて次元削減を行うことで、計算効率を劇的に向上できます。GoogleのBERTモデルでも、この手法が活用されています。

2. 微分積分:勾配降下法の数学的理解

AIの学習アルゴリズムの多くは、損失関数の最小化を目指します。ここで重要になるのが微分です。勾配降下法では、損失関数の偏微分を計算し、その勾配方向に重みを更新していきます。

実装ポイント:確率的勾配降下法(SGD)だけでなく、AdamやRMSpropなどの最適化アルゴリズムの違いを理解し、問題に応じて適切に選択することで、収束速度を大幅に改善できます。OpenAIのGPTモデルではAdamWが採用されています。

3. 確率統計:不確実性のモデル化

機械学習の本質は確率モデルの構築にあります。ベイズ定理を理解することで、事前確率と観測データから事後確率を求め、予測の信頼度を評価できるようになります。

実装ポイント:ベイジアンニューラルネットワークを実装することで、単なる予測値だけでなく、その不確実性も定量化できます。医療診断AIなど、リスク評価が重要な領域で特に価値があります。MITのリサーチグループが開発したDropoutを用いた近似ベイズ推論は、実装が比較的容易でありながら効果的です。

4. 情報理論:最適な表現学習

情報理論の概念、特にエントロピーや相互情報量は、特徴抽出や表現学習において重要です。VAE(変分オートエンコーダ)やGAN(敵対的生成ネットワーク)の背後には、情報理論的な裏付けがあります。

実装ポイント:クロスエントロピー損失関数の代わりに、KLダイバージェンスを取り入れることで、確率分布の差異をより適切にモデル化できます。FacebookのAI研究チームが開発したCPC(Contrastive Predictive Coding)は、この概念を実装した好例です。

5. トポロジー:データ構造の理解

高次元データの幾何学的構造を理解するために、トポロジーの知識が役立ちます。マニフォールド学習やパーシステントホモロジーなどの手法は、複雑なデータ構造を視覚化し、隠れたパターンを発見するのに役立ちます。

実装ポイント:t-SNEやUMAPなどの次元削減アルゴリズムは、トポロジカルな考え方を取り入れており、高次元データの可視化に非常に効果的です。Googleの研究者たちが開発したトポロジカルデータ分析ツールキットは、複雑なデータセットの構造理解に役立ちます。

これらの数学的概念は単なる理論ではなく、実際のAI開発において具体的な課題解決に直結します。例えば、DeepMindのAlphaGoは、モンテカルロ木探索と強化学習の数学的基盤があったからこそ実現できました。AIエンジニアとして成長したいなら、これらの数学的概念をただ知識として持つだけでなく、実装レベルで理解することが重要です。数学とAIの深い結びつきを理解することで、より革新的なソリューションを生み出せるようになるでしょう。

4. 「なぜ今、数学者がAI業界で求められているのか – 急増する需要と年収事情」

# タイトル: AIと数学のコラボレーションで生まれるイノベーション

## 見出し: 4. 「なぜ今、数学者がAI業界で求められているのか – 急増する需要と年収事情」

AI技術の急速な発展に伴い、数学者の需要が爆発的に高まっています。かつて理論的な学問と見なされていた数学が、今や最先端テクノロジーの中核を担うようになりました。Google、Microsoft、OpenAIといった大手テック企業は競うように数学のバックグラウンドを持つ人材を採用しています。

数学者がAI業界で重宝される理由は明確です。機械学習アルゴリズムの根幹には線形代数、確率論、最適化理論などの高度な数学的概念が不可欠だからです。特に深層学習モデルの設計や改良には、複雑な数学的思考が必要とされます。

実際、AI研究の最前線では「変分オートエンコーダー」や「トポロジカルデータ解析」など、純粋数学の知識を応用した革新的手法が次々と開発されています。これらの手法を理解し実装できる数学者は、業界内で貴重な存在となっています。

年収面でも数学者の価値は高評価されています。シリコンバレーでは、PhD取得の数学者がAI関連ポジションで年間20万ドル(約2,200万円)以上の報酬を得ることは珍しくありません。特に確率論や位相幾何学などの特定分野に精通した専門家は、さらに高い報酬を期待できます。

日本国内でも、楽天やPreferred Networksなどの企業が数学バックグラウンドを持つAI研究者を積極採用しており、年収1,500万円を超えるケースも増えています。単なるプログラミングスキルだけでなく、アルゴリズムの理論的基盤を理解できる人材への需要は今後も拡大する見込みです。

興味深いことに、この需要増加は教育界にも影響を及ぼしています。多くの大学が数学とコンピュータサイエンスを融合させた新しいカリキュラムを開発し、将来のAI研究者育成に力を入れています。東京大学の数理情報学科やカーネギーメロン大学の計算数学プログラムはその代表例です。

企業側も人材確保のために様々な取り組みを行っています。Googleは「数学者向けAIブートキャンプ」を開催し、DeepMindは純粋数学の研究者を直接リクルートするプログラムを展開しています。

数学者にとって、AI業界は理論を実世界の問題に応用できる絶好の場となっています。抽象的な概念が実際のプロダクトやサービスに変わる過程を目の当たりにできることは、多くの数学者にとって大きな魅力です。

結論として、AI技術が社会のあらゆる領域に浸透するにつれ、その基盤となる数学的思考を持つ人材の価値は今後も高まり続けるでしょう。数学とAIの融合は、単なるトレンドではなく、テクノロジー発展の本質的な方向性を示しています。

5. 「数学を制する者がAIを制する – 学生のうちに身につけておきたい数理的思考とスキル」

# タイトル: AIと数学のコラボレーションで生まれるイノベーション

## 見出し: 5. 「数学を制する者がAIを制する – 学生のうちに身につけておきたい数理的思考とスキル」

AIの急速な発展において、数学はその根幹を支える学問として再評価されています。実際、機械学習やディープラーニングのアルゴリズムは、線形代数、微積分、確率統計などの数学的概念に深く根ざしています。将来AIエンジニアやデータサイエンティストを目指す学生にとって、早い段階で数学的思考を身につけることは大きなアドバンテージとなるでしょう。

特に重要なのは「抽象化能力」です。複雑な問題を単純な数式やモデルに落とし込み、本質を見抜く力は、AIアルゴリズムの設計において不可欠です。例えば、Google DeepMindのエンジニアたちは、複雑な意思決定問題を数学的に定式化することで、AlphaGoやAlphaFoldなどの革新的なAIを生み出しました。

また、論理的思考も必須スキルです。if-thenの構造や、帰納法・演繹法による推論は、プログラミングとAI開発の基礎となります。Microsoftのリサーチチームでは、論理的整合性を保ったアルゴリズム設計が、信頼性の高いAIシステム開発の鍵だと強調しています。

確率と統計の理解も欠かせません。不確実性を扱う数学的枠組みは、機械学習の予測モデルの核心部分です。Amazonや Netflix などの企業は、確率モデルを活用したレコメンデーションシステムで成功を収めています。

さらに、最適化理論の基礎知識も重要です。コスト関数の最小化など、AIの学習プロセスは本質的に最適化問題です。OpenAIのGPTモデルも、膨大なパラメータの最適化によって性能を向上させています。

数学的思考を鍛えるには、理論だけでなく実践も重要です。kaggleなどのデータサイエンスコンペティションへの参加や、実際のデータセットを使った小規模プロジェクトに取り組むことで、数学的知識を実世界の問題に適用する経験を積むことができます。

学生時代から数学とプログラミングを組み合わせた学習を進めることで、AIの原理を深く理解し、将来的に独自のアルゴリズムやモデルを開発できる土台を築くことができるでしょう。数学は単なる道具ではなく、AIの世界を探索するための地図と羅針盤なのです。

よかったらシェアしてね!
  • URLをコピーしました!
  • URLをコピーしました!

この記事を書いた人

コメント

コメントする